I have an email message
$msg = 'Name: $fname ' . ' $lname\n'
. "Phone: $phone\n"
. "Email: $email\n"
and it works fine, however in this message there are about 30 variables that
are being called...as such
. "Order: beefschnitzel $beefschnitzel\n"
. "Order: beefstrips $beefstrips\n"
. "Order: cheesesausage $cheesesausage\n"
. "Order: crumbedsausage $crumbedsausage\n"
. "Order: chucksteak $chucksteak\n"
. "Order: cornedbeef $cornedbeef\n"
. "Order: dicedsteak $dicedsteak\n"
. "Order: filletmignon $filletmignon\n"
I want to only send the message if the submitter enters an amount in the
form for the corresponding variable, instead of having a bunch of empty
messages. So I have been trying to use the empty() function as such:
. if empty($beefolives){''} elseif (isset($beefolives)) { 'Order: beefolives
$beefolives\n'}
But I am getting the error
Parse error: syntax error, unexpected T_IF
Can someone point me in the right direction?
